Definitions:

Unrealized Gain-Equity

The increase in the value of investments that a company holds in other companies' stocks, which have not been sold and thus the gain has not been realized.

Debt Securities

Financial instruments representing a loan made by an investor to a borrower, typically corporate or governmental, which include terms related to the amount, interest rate, and maturity date.

Maturity Value

The amount payable to the holder of a financial instrument at its maturity date, often the principal plus any final interest payment.

Owner Relationship

The legal and operational connections and responsibilities between the owner(s) and their business entity.
